If you’re planning on watching on an Apple TV, you’ll have to convert the files from MKV to MP4 H.264 too, as the former isn’t supported by the device. The lower the RF setting, the less compressed and therefore sharper the image, but higher settings will give you smaller file sizes.

It all depends on how much space you have on your external hard drive, NAS or whatever you’re using as a storage device for your newly ripped movie collection.Ī constant quality encode is recommended, but which RF quality setting you use in HandBrake is up to you. You can keep the original 1920 x 1080 resolution if you wish, as it’s supported by the latest Apple TV, but reducing it to a 1280 x 720 (720p) resolution will drastically cut down on the file size while maintaining HD quality. HandBrake has a selection of preset formats that change the resolution to suit different device’s screens (such as that of the Apple TV), or you can can set your own. So you’re probably going to want to compress the file down to something more manageable, and that’s where HandBrake steps in.

MakeMKV rips a movie uncompressed at full 1080p resolution, and that takes up a lot of space. Both are free (well, to be precise MakeMKV is currently free, while it’s still in beta) and relatively easy to use. While there are lots of options available, we suggest MakeMKV for the former and HandBrake for the latter.

Just be wary that the quality may not be as high as with branded drives. If you’re a thrift-meister, there are bags of OEM drives at piffling price points spread across the web. Plextor offers a USB drive for about £60, but if you’re willing to spend a little more there’s a gloriously skinny Samsung model (which writes too – bonus!) for around £75. The good news is that, because it just needs to be able to read Blu-ray discs and not write them, there are plenty of dirt cheap options around.
